What your day will look like:
Help advisors use industry standard software, APEXA, to support contracting efforts
Review contracting requirements with the advisor when new business is received, and provide guidance and assistance until completion
Process advisor Buy/Sell agreements on block transfers and reassignments to ensure full servicing and commission changes reflecting the new advisor and HUB Financial as the MGA
Establish and maintain excellent working relationships with carriers and work in partnership with them to ensure contracts are processed quickly
Maintain accurate data in our system, WealthServ, including the broker contract, compensation hierarchy, compliance data, and notes
Ensure advisor contracting applications are screened fully, looking for poor credit, completeness and accuracy. Review all documentation for missing information and obtain all necessary outstanding requirements proactively
Document and escalate any action required relating to advisor credit, conduct or compliance issues based on facts gathered from Insurance Councils, carrier head offices or other information obtained by HUB Financial
Follow up with all insurance carriers to ensure all contracting and licensing submissions are processed in a timely manner
